The Department of Site-Specific Art at the University of Applied Arts Vienna offers the possibility for a remote portfolio consultation via zoom on November 18, 2020.
Lecturers and the team of the department will be at zoom from 2 until 4 pm to answer all of your questions concerning our program and your portfolio.

Please, pre-register via email: sitespecificart@uni-ak.ac.at


The Department of Site-Specific Art is part of the Institute of Fine Arts and Media Art.
The diploma program requires a minimum of eight semesters to complete. Because of our international students and lecturers, classes are taught in German/English.

We encourage students to develop and implement their own ideas and projects; this includes:
- Theory and practice with a wide range of course offerings
- Studio spaces and equipment
- Public exhibition space for students of the department
- Exhibition and studio visits, field trips
- Lectures, workshops, and round table events with international guests
- Cross-disciplinary exchange and cooperation with students from painting, photography, graphic design,
sculpture, and media arts programs, among others
- International study abroad / exchange programs
- The university's annual exhibition
- Students and lectures with broad backgrounds
- Individual feedback
- Discussions and project work in groups
- Working with text
- Wood, metal, and mold-making and casting workshop
- Photo, video, and sound workshop
